Srila Prabhupada, a glorious modern sage, shares his love with all he meets, via his profound teachings, which bring to life Lord Chaitanya's message: how to develop pure love for Krishna, or God. Srila Prabhupada's outstanding personality - his transcendental desires, qualities, character and personal history - is abundantly expressed in his lectures, conversations, letters and, to some degree, in his books. An endearing presentation on what he did not is found within this Vaniquotes category - I Did Not (Prabhupada).

An introduction is given below in the following 8 quotes.
